High-Quality Dental Crowns in Calgary
A crown is also called a “dental cap’’. Unlike fillings, which only fill in part of the tooth, the crown completely covers the tooth above the gum line, preventing a weak tooth from breaking or holding parts of a broken tooth together. Crowns are usually made up of either porcelain or gold or a combination of both. They are generally used when a tooth is so damaged that it needs to be rebuilt. Since a crown is cemented into place, it not only becomes the new outer surface for your tooth but also strengthens its integrity. Benefits of Dental Crowns
Dental crowns are more than just dental caps. They offer a number of benefits to the patient. Some of them are listed below:
- Crowns help in strengthening your damaged tooth and put a stop to any further damage
- Crowns help in restoring the original shape and structure of the tooth
- Crowns become a permanent part of your mouth and can last a very long time with just standard hygiene practices
- Crowns can help in preventing further damage by creating a protective layer on the damaged or broken tooth
